Codegrip is an automated code review tool that makes the code review process a matter of seconds. Codegrip provides detailed code review reports within a few seconds, automatically scans the code for bugs, code smells and vulnerabilities when the developer commits the code. It also Informs you about duplication percentage in the code along with duplicated blocks, files, and lines. Apart from this Codegrip also tells the user how much time would take to fix the bugs and gives suggested solutions to fix them. It is the only automated code review platform that does not store the user's code, keeping their IP safe.

Pluralsight features and specs

  • Comprehensive Course Library
    Pluralsight provides a vast array of courses across various domains including software development, IT, data science, and creative skills. This makes it a one-stop platform for diverse learning needs.
  • Skill Assessments
    The platform offers skill assessments that help users identify their proficiency levels and track their learning progress over time, enabling personalized learning experiences.
  • Expert Instructors
    Courses are taught by industry experts who have substantial experience and knowledge in their respective fields, ensuring high-quality course content.
  • Offline Access
    Pluralsight allows users to download courses for offline viewing, which is convenient for learners who may not always have a stable internet connection.
  • Certification Preparation
    Pluralsight offers specialized courses aimed at helping users prepare for industry certifications, enhancing their professional credentials.
  • Business Solutions
    The platform offers business plans that include analytics and tools to help organizations upskill their teams effectively.
  • Regular Updates
    Courses and content are regularly updated to reflect the latest industry trends and technologies, ensuring users have access to current information.

Possible disadvantages of Pluralsight

  • Cost
    Pluralsight is generally pricier compared to some other online learning platforms. The subscription model can be expensive for individual users not sponsored by an employer.
  • Limited Interactivity
    While Pluralsight offers high-quality content, the courses are mostly video-based with limited interactivity, which might not be ideal for learners who prefer hands-on learning experiences.
  • Content Overlap
    Some users have reported that certain courses have overlapping content, making it redundant for users looking for specific and diverse learning materials.
  • No Free Tier
    Unlike some competitors, Pluralsight does not offer a free tier for ongoing access to courses, which can be a drawback for individuals looking to explore the platform before committing financially.
  • Completion Certificates
    Pluralsight does not offer accredited certificates upon course completion, which can be a drawback for learners looking to add course certificates to their resumes or LinkedIn profiles.
  • User Interface
    Some users have reported that the user interface can be somewhat cumbersome and not as intuitive as other learning platforms.

Codegrip features and specs

  • Automated Code Review
    Codegrip automates the process of reviewing code by analyzing the codebase for any vulnerabilities, bugs, or code smells, saving time and reducing human error.
  • Integration Capabilities
    It integrates with popular version control systems like GitHub, GitLab, and Bitbucket, allowing seamless integration into existing workflows.
  • Real-time Feedback
    The platform provides real-time feedback on code quality, enabling developers to address issues promptly and improve code quality continuously.
  • Multi-Language Support
    Supports a wide range of programming languages, making it a versatile tool for teams working with multiple tech stacks.
  • Detailed Reports
    Generates comprehensive reports on code quality, offering insights into specific issues and recommendations on how to resolve them.

Possible disadvantages of Codegrip

  • Pricing
    Some users may find the pricing model of Codegrip to be expensive, especially for small teams or individual developers.
  • Learning Curve
    New users might face a learning curve when adjusting to the platform and understanding its full range of features and functionalities.
  • Limited Customization
    There could be limitations in customizing code review rules and alerts to suit the specific needs of diverse projects.
  • Dependency on Integration
    The effectiveness of Codegrip heavily relies on its integration with other tools, which might lead to challenges if such integrations are not set up properly.
  • Performance
    In some instances, users may experience performance issues, such as lag or delays in analysis, especially with larger codebases.
